From 26ddcbb441e81a228de345669b8540b8318a08e8 Mon Sep 17 00:00:00 2001 From: Brian Campbell Date: Wed, 15 May 2019 15:51:10 +0100 Subject: 94f445 introduced a new name for _ref_deref, add it to the effect rewriting --- src/rewrites.ml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'src') diff --git a/src/rewrites.ml b/src/rewrites.ml index 7ff500b9..c10d931d 100644 --- a/src/rewrites.ml +++ b/src/rewrites.ml @@ -1903,7 +1903,7 @@ let rewrite_fix_val_specs env (Defs defs) = let (TypSchm_aux (TypSchm_ts (tq, typ), _)) = typschm in (* Add rreg effect to internal _reg_deref function (cf. bitfield.ml) *) let vs = - if string_of_id id = "_reg_deref" then + if string_of_id id = "_reg_deref" || string_of_id id = "__bitfield_deref" then add_eff_to_vs (mk_effect [BE_rreg]) (tq, typ) else (tq, typ) in typschm, Bindings.add id vs val_specs -- cgit v1.2.3